Local Ohio Residents React to Ney's Sentencing
Posted: 5:50 pm EST January 19,2007
Resident’s from Bob Ney's district reacted to the news of his jail sentence, and the work he did as a congressman of the 18-th congressional district.Belmont County was part of Ney's district and current county employees who worked with Ney said he did a lot of good things for his district while in office and brought in lots of money to the area.Others said regardless of what good he's done, he should be forced to serve time for the laws he broke.Many noted that they are glad to hear that Ney is confronting his problem with alcohol abuse."After what he did I think he did deserve it, being in that position. You trust those people and for what he did, I just don't think it's acceptable," said Brennan Smith of St. Clairsville."I’m glad [he’s getting help for alcohol abuse]. A lot of people in this area have alcohol problems and I think that it’s good that he's doing that," said Tammy Archer of St. Clairsville."Regardless of which side of the coin you were on politically I think Bob Ney served his constituents very well in the entire district," said Belmont County Commissioner Mark Thomas,Thomas said he thinks that Ney got caught up in a situation that other political figures could easily get caught up in as well.Ney will spend his sentence at a Morgantown federal prison, where he'll get treatment for his alcohol problems.
